1. Eco-Friendly Pools
In the modern world, sustainability is key. Homeowners are increasingly seeking energy-efficient solutions for everything, including their pools. Eco-friendly pools focus on using less energy and water while maintaining optimal performance.
Key features of eco-friendly pools include:
- Solar-powered heating systems: These systems use the sun’s energy to warm pool water, reducing energy consumption.
- Natural filtration systems: Using plants and natural materials, these systems reduce the need for chemicals, making the water more eco-friendly.
- Energy-efficient pumps and lights: Reducing energy consumption without sacrificing pool functionality is a key priority for homeowners looking for sustainable solutions.

3. Smart Pool Technology
Technology continues to revolutionize every aspect of our lives, and luxury pools are no exception. Smart pools bring convenience and advanced functionality to pool management, making it easier than ever to control various pool systems.
Smart features include:
- Automated cleaning systems: These systems allow your pool to stay pristine with minimal effort.
- Remote temperature control: Adjust the pool temperature from anywhere using a smartphone app.
- Lighting control: Set the ambiance with smart LED lights that can be adjusted remotely to suit any occasion.

4. Wellness-Focused Pools
As wellness and health trends continue to rise, pools are becoming more than just a place to swim—they’re becoming holistic wellness spaces. Pools are now being designed with features that promote relaxation, fitness, and well-being.
Some popular wellness-focused pool features include:
- Hydrotherapy jets: These jets provide a therapeutic massage, ideal for relieving stress and tension.
- Built-in spas: A pool that includes a hot tub or spa features enhances relaxation and adds a luxury touch.
- Resistance pools: These pools are equipped with water jets that provide resistance for swimmers, making them ideal for fitness enthusiasts.
A wellness-centric pool design can help you unwind after a long day, offering a combination of relaxation and fitness in one space.

- What is the difference between an infinity pool and a zero-edge pool?
An infinity pool creates the illusion of water spilling over one edge, while a zero-edge pool has no visible boundary, offering a seamless look that blends with the surroundings.
